Helpdesk 

Annual Salary: £26k - £28k

Location: To be confirmed

Job Type: Full-time

Hours of Work: Monday to Friday, 8am to 4pm

My client is seeking a Helpdesk candidate to join their established and well-respected team on a permanent basis This role is perfect for someone who is friendly, collaborative, and reliable, with previous helpdesk experience.

Day-to-day of the role:

  • Manage planned preventative maintenance (ppm) and reactive maintenance
  • Allocate jobs to engineers and ensure the completion of works and deadlines met
  • Submit detailed job reports to clients and send them along with quotes
  • Support the Contracts Manager
  • Utilise Job Logic software to track and manage maintenance tasks.
  • Manage both shared and personal inboxes, ensuring all communications are handled efficiently.
  • Take calls and respond to emails, providing excellent customer service.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• Previous experience in a helpdesk or planning / scheduling role.
  • Ability to manage a high volume of calls and emails.
  • Experience with Job Logic or similar job management software is advantageous.
  • A friendly, collaborative, and reliable work ethic.
